Python(32)_元组中嵌套列表的修改

#-*-coding:utf-8-*-
'''
元组:只读列表,可循环查询,可切片
儿子不能改,孙子可能可以改
'''
tu = (1,2,3,'alex',[2,3,4,'abnowen'],'encho')
print(tu[3])  # alex
print(tu[:4]) # (1, 2, 3, 'alex')
# 遍历
'''1
2
3
alex
[2, 3, 4, 5]
encho'''
for i in  tu:
    print(i)

# 元组中的列表是可以修改的
tu[4][3] = tu[4][3].upper()
print(tu[4])  # [2, 3, 4, 'ABNOWEN']

# 添加
tu[4].append('sb')
print(tu[4]) # [2, 3, 4, 'ABNOWEN', 'sb']

Python(32)_元组中嵌套列表的修改_第1张图片

 

转载于:https://www.cnblogs.com/sunnybowen/p/10204864.html

你可能感兴趣的:(Python(32)_元组中嵌套列表的修改)